Claude Gauthier, of Broomfield, Colorado, formerly of Antigo died July 6, 2016 in Broomfield. He was 101 years old. He was born on September 3, 1914 in Hayes, WI, a son of Charles and Irene (Navarre) Gauthier. He married Joyce Heinzen on May 17, 1947. She preceded him in death on March 11, 2004.

Claude served in the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C) from July 1934 to Sep 1935.
He was also a veteran of the US Army Air Corps and served from Sep 1941 to Feb 1946.

Claude worked as a welder on the railroad for many years.

He was a member of the Leland-Tollefson Veterans of Forgein Wars Pos #2653, Antigo.

Survivors include two daughters, Carmen (Jeffrey) Kobacker of Scottsdale, AZ, Marcella (Dan) Artz of St. Nazianz; three sons, Paul (Patrice) Gauthier of Broomfield, CO, Allen Gauthier of Spokane, WA, Larry Gauthier of Hub City, WI.

In addition to his wife he was preceded in death by four sisters, Bernadette Holbrook, Sr. Rebecca Gauthier, Mary Reetz, and Lucille Shadduck; two brothers, Leon and Cyril Gauthier.

A funeral service will be held on Sep 18 at 10:30 am at Bradley Funeral Home. Burial will take place in Queen of Peace Cemetery. Visitation will be from 10:00 am until the time of services at the funeral home.
